Regional Volleyball Results

The Leyton Lady Warriors defeated the Potter-Dix Lady Coyotes Tuesday night at Potter in straight sets 3-to-0. The Lady Warriors started strong with a 25-to-15 victory in the first set then a 25-to-8 victory in the second set. The Lady Coyotes battled back in the third set, but fell short 25-to-23 to end the match with a Leyton victory. Leyton's record improved to 18-and-6 while Potter-Dix fell to 9-and-16.

Creek Valley's Lady Storm had a rough week, losing to the Mitchell Lady Tigers 2-to-0 on Tuesday. Mitchell's dominant front line had no trouble dispatching the Lady Storm in straight sets 25-to-6 and 25-to-17. The Lady Storm also fell 2-to-0 against the Bayard Lady Tigers, losing in straight sets 25-to-16 and 25-to-16. Junior Chloe Stupka had 5 kills in the defeat. Creek Valley also lost to the South Platte Lady Blue Knights in a tight contest, losing the first set 25-to-22 then the second 25-to-20. Junior Kayla Collins had 13 digs in the loss. Creek Valley's season record fell to 5-and-18 with the losses.

Peetz's Lady Bulldogs traveled to Merino to take on the Lady Rams, and were unable to take a set from the home team, falling 25-to-7, 25-to-11, and 25-to-11 for a three sets to zero loss. Sophomore LaKrisha Fehringer had nine digs and 13 service receptions in the loss.
